[[https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/AGFG1_HUMAN AGFG1_HUMAN]] Required for vesicle docking or fusion during acrosome biogenesis (By similarity). May play a role in RNA trafficking or localization. In case of infection by HIV-1, acts as a cofactor for viral Rev and promotes movement of Rev-responsive element-containing RNAs from the nuclear periphery to the cytoplasm. This step is essential for HIV-1 replication.<ref>PMID:10613896</ref> <ref>PMID:14701878</ref> <ref>PMID:15749819</ref>
